#4d2432 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4d2432 is composed of 30.2% red, 14.1%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.2% magenta, 35.1% yellow and 69.8% black. It has a hue angle of 339.5 degrees, a saturation of 36.3% and a lightness of 22.2%. #4d2432 color hex could be obtained by blending #9a4864 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#4d2432 color description : Very dark desaturated pink.

#4d2432 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4d2432 has RGB values of R:77, G:36, B:50 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.53, Y:0.35, K:0.7. Its decimal value is 5055538.

Shades and Tints of #4d2432

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0507 is the darkest color, while #fefc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#4d2432

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3c3538 is the less saturated color, while #700127 is the most saturated one.
